Built in 1899 and converted into a stylish home, this detached property offers a great space for a family holiday and features a 25ft stained glass window in the living room. There is much to see and do in the surrounding areas; Afan Argoed Forestry Park is excellent for mountain biking and has been rated in the top ten of the world for mountain bike rides. The stunning Brecon Beacons and Black Mountains offer breathtaking scenery and fabulous walking, and there are several waterfalls within a 15-minute walk. Margam Country Park is well worth a visit, with its castle, 18th-century orangery, narrow gauge railway, deer, Fairytale Land and Go Ape tree top adventure. Zip World is also just 10 minutes’ away. Visit Dan yr Ogof Showcaves which also offer wedding ceremonies. Quad biking, archery and paintballing can all be found in the surrounding areas, along with fishing, golf and horse riding. Slightly further afield is the stunning Gower Peninsula, Britain’s first designated Area of Outstanding Natural Beauty, with beautiful expanses of sandy beaches, hidden coves and coastal walks. Brecon, Swansea and Cardiff, the bustling capital city, are within approximately a 45-minute drive. Property is 100 yards from ref UK37640. Shop 50 yards, pub 250 yards, restaurant 1 mile.

We chose St Albans Church as a location to celebrate milestone birthdays with the family.
We chose St Albans Church as a location to celebrate milestone birthdays with the family. It had everything we look for - several bathrooms, alternative seating areas so we can spread out a bit, something to entertain the kids and a location that's not too remote as we do like to have easy access to a shop. Arranging access was easy with a key safe code provided and the directions were clear. On arrival the property was warm and welcoming bottles of milk and wine were left for us. There was not quite as much credit on the gas meter as we expected, but a quick phone call to Jason remedied this and a few other things that needed attention the next day. Unfortunately it took a couple of days to fix the spa bath that we had all been looking forward to trying, but it was worth the wait when we finally got to enjoy the bubbles after a long walk on the only dry day. Access to Netflix and an XBox was probably the highlight of the teens' week, although we all enjoyed playing pool and doing some of the provided jigsaws as well. We didn't get out and about much as the weather was not great, but that's to be expected in Wales during March and we had a very relaxing time. It was worth the walk to the waterfalls and the museum in Swansea was interesting. A great property for a relaxing week away with no pressure to be out and about everyday was just what we wanted and what we got!
